Transaction 5ed860ac14116f8e72f5fad66f4a20044c636e4a2990f3cc61b8a24f9d3e0302
1 Input
1 Output
-
5ed860ac14116f8e72f5fad66f4a20044c636e4a2990f3cc61b8a24f9d3e0302:0
- value
- 229759373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76938a51d5ca32c7a53546c56769276124c3522e OP_EQUAL
- address
- 3CVzQTeeNBK54AFbaxQhyZXhHwpTP4Sy6f